+# we wrap the CMake add_test() function in order to automatically set up test
+# dependencies for the 'unit' and 'check' test targets.
+#
+# this function extravagantly tries to work around a bug in CMake where we
+# cannot pass an empty string through this wrapper to add_test().  passed as a
+# list (e.g., via ARGN, ARGV, or manually composed), the empty string is
+# skipped(!).  passed as a string, it is all treated as command name with no
+# arguments.
+#
+# manual workaround used here involves invoking _add_test() with all args
+# individually recreated/specified (i.e., not as a list) as this preserves
+# empty strings.  this approach means we cannot generalize and only support a
+# limited variety of empty string arguments, but we do test and halt if someone
+# unknowingly tries.
+function(BRLCAD_ADD_TEST NAME test_name COMMAND test_prog)
